网络安全可视化如何展示网络攻击路径?

在当今信息化时代,网络安全问题日益突出,网络攻击手段也层出不穷。为了更好地防御网络攻击,了解攻击路径变得至关重要。网络安全可视化作为一种直观、高效的方法,能够帮助我们清晰地展示网络攻击路径,从而提高网络安全防护能力。本文将深入探讨网络安全可视化如何展示网络攻击路径,以期为网络安全工作者提供有益的参考。

一、网络安全可视化概述

网络安全可视化是指利用图形、图像、动画等形式,将网络安全事件、攻击路径、防护措施等信息进行直观展示的技术。它能够帮助人们快速理解复杂的安全问题,提高网络安全防护水平。

二、网络安全可视化展示网络攻击路径的原理

网络安全可视化展示网络攻击路径主要基于以下原理:

  1. 数据可视化:将网络流量、设备状态、安全事件等数据转化为图形、图像等形式,使人们能够直观地了解网络运行状态和攻击路径。

  2. 关联分析:通过分析网络中的设备、流量、协议等信息,找出攻击者可能利用的漏洞和攻击路径。

  3. 实时监控:实时监测网络流量和安全事件,及时发现异常情况,快速定位攻击路径。

三、网络安全可视化展示网络攻击路径的方法

  1. 拓扑图:通过拓扑图展示网络中各个设备之间的连接关系,以及攻击者可能利用的漏洞和攻击路径。例如,使用Node.js、D3.js等前端技术实现网络拓扑图的动态展示。

  2. 流量分析:通过分析网络流量,展示攻击者可能利用的漏洞和攻击路径。例如,使用Wireshark等工具捕获网络流量,然后利用Elasticsearch、Kibana等工具进行可视化展示。

  3. 攻击路径追踪:通过追踪攻击者留下的痕迹,展示攻击路径。例如,使用Python等编程语言编写脚本,分析日志文件,找出攻击路径。

  4. 安全事件可视化:将安全事件以图形、图像等形式展示,使人们能够直观地了解攻击者的攻击手法和攻击目标。

四、案例分析

  1. 勒索软件攻击:通过网络安全可视化,我们可以清晰地看到勒索软件的攻击路径。攻击者首先通过漏洞入侵目标系统,然后释放勒索软件,加密用户数据,并要求支付赎金。

  2. 钓鱼攻击:网络安全可视化可以帮助我们了解钓鱼攻击的路径。攻击者通过发送伪装成正规网站的邮件,诱导用户点击链接,从而窃取用户信息。

五、总结

网络安全可视化作为一种直观、高效的方法,能够帮助我们清晰地展示网络攻击路径,提高网络安全防护能力。通过拓扑图、流量分析、攻击路径追踪、安全事件可视化等方法,我们可以更好地了解网络攻击,从而制定有效的防御策略。在网络安全领域,不断探索和应用网络安全可视化技术,将有助于我们更好地应对日益严峻的网络安全挑战。

猜你喜欢:网络可视化